+In the future, mentors have to notify their respective PMC that they intend
+to mentor a GSoC project. The PMC has to acknowledge and a waiting period 
+of 72 hours starts during which objections can be voiced. A notification 
+template will be made available to prospective mentors.
 
 In addition, we will ask infrastructure to create a special group which
 holders of temporary accounts, i.e. GSoC students, have to be a member
-of. This group will be modifiable by pmc-chairs and comdev-pmc.
+of. This group will be modifiable by pmc-chairs and comdev-pmc, and 
+will allow such temporary accounts to be reviewed and if needed closed
+in due time.
